I was there in late 2019, just before they shut down for Covid. The Blue Lagoon rooms were being remodeled at that time. Don't know if they finished yet. It isn't a 5 star, or even a 4 star resort. It is a bed to sleep in, a shower to clean up in. You really don't go there to hang out in the rooms. It is a nice resort in a third world country.odyssey has nicer rooms, unlimited nitrox, plenty of o2 for deco, preblended trimix, and can do more dives a day. blue lagoon actually has slightly better food, but the rooms are decrepit. maybe it was nice back in the 70s, but it looks like it hasn't been renovated since. you can dive right off the back of the odyssey for several of the wrecks and the lift is useful to get in and out with stages clipped on.
